The story of Pieter Barend\Barendse Botha began in 1803 in Cape Town, Western Cape, South Africa. Pieter Barend\Barendse Botha married Merge, and had children including Helena Catharina Botha Appel, Pieter Barend Botha. Pieter Barend\Barendse Botha passed away in 1880 in Paling Kloof,Cape,South Africa.
